Collected by Ibn Mājah
ibnmajah:2241Muḥammad b. Ismāʿīl > Wakīʿ > al-Masʿūdī > Jābir > Abū al-Ḍuḥá > Masrūq > ʿAbdullāh b. Masʿūd > Ashhad > al-Ṣādiq al-Maṣdūq Abū al-Qāsim ﷺ

"I bear witness that the true and truly inspired one Abul-Qasim ﷺ told us: 'Selling a Muhaffalah is Khilabah, and Khilabah is not lawful for the Muslim."' (Ibn Majah said: " Meaning: 'Deception.")

ابن ماجة:٢٢٤١حَدَّثَنَا م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 إِسْمَاعِيلَ حَدَّثَنَا وَكِيعٌ حَدَّثَنَا الْمَسْعُودِيُّ عَنْ جَابِرٍ عَنْ أَبِي الضُّحَى عَنْ مَسْرُوقٍ ع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 مَسْعُودٍ

أَنَّهُ قَالَ أَشْهَدُ عَلَى الصَّادِقِ الْمَصْدُوقِ أَبِي الْقَاسِمِ ﷺ أَنَّهُ حَدَّثَنَا قَالَ بَيْعُ الْمُحَفَّلاَتِ خِلاَبَةٌ وَلاَ تَحِلُّ الْخِلاَبَةُ لِمُسْلِمٍ
